New York, NY, Sept. 8, 2021—Federal Emergency Management Agency (FEMA) personnel help residents apply for assistance after heavy rains from the remnants of Tropical Cyclone Ida flooded their neighborhoods. FEMA, along with other federal agencies, are working together at NYC Service Centers to provide information about available programs. K.C. Wilsey/FEMA
